The objective of this study is to present our experience with the use of infrared laser with (ƛ) 904 nm, for treatment of bone resorption in dental implants in process of osseointegration. Material and methods: we present a clinical case of treatment of bone resorption around the apex of an implant in process of osseointegration. Low-level laser therapy (LLLT) in the infrared specter with (λ) 904 nm was used for the treatment. Six procedures were performed, every other day, with a dose of 3-4 J/ cm2. Results: The radiography performed about three months after the treatment showed recovery of the bone resorption. Conclusion: The use of laser in the infrared specter with (λ) 904 nm, for treatment of bone resorption in dental implants in process of osseointegration, following a protocol of six sessions every other day with dose of 3-4 J/ cm2 per session, leads to recovery of the bone structure.
